IHR urges Tinubu to appoint remaining NAHCON board members 

The Independent Hajj Reporters (IHR) has called on President Bola Tinubu to appoint the remaining members of the board of the National Hajj Commission of Nigeria (NAHCON) as enshrined on its establishment act.

The president had on October 17, 2023 announced the appointment of Malam Jalal Ahmad Arabi as the Ag chairman of the country’s apex hajj regulatory body.

The president also announced additional members of the board and forwarded same to the Senate for confirmation. They have all been confirmed and inaugurated into office.

IHR in a statement Thursday in Abuja signed by its national coordinator, Ibrahim Mohammed, said the new board of NAHCON is still incomplete.

Section 3 of NAHCON Establishment ACT 2006 under composition of leadership of the commission clearly states that “the commission shall consist of the – (a) a chairman, who shall be-, (i) Chief executive and accounting officer of the commission; (ii) responsible to the commission for the day-to-day management of the affairs of the commission;

B (b) three full-time members and six part-time members representing each geo- political zone provided that two of whom shall be women;

(c) a representative each of the Ministry of- (i) Aviation; (ii) Foreign Affairs; (iii) Internal Affairs (Immigration);  (iv) Finance;  (v) Health;  (d) a representative of the-  (i) Central Bank of Nigeria; (ii) Jama’atul Nasril Islam; and (iii) Nigerian Supreme Council for Islamic Affairs.”   

Based on the recent appointments by Mr. President, it is clear that representatives of some key agencies are still missing and this may affect the smooth running of hajj operations in the country.
